C++-based high-performance parallel environment execution engine (vectorized env) for general RL environments.
-
Updated
Jun 6, 2024 - C++
C++-based high-performance parallel environment execution engine (vectorized env) for general RL environments.
ThreadPoolManager is a C++ project that implements an efficient multi-threading system using a thread pool for generic functions of the same type and different tasks. It includes task management, synchronization mechanisms, and thread-safe logging to demonstrate concurrent task execution.
An OpenMP C port of pixelmatch, the smallest, simplest and fastest JavaScript pixel-level image comparison library.
Efficient Resource Sharing across Heterogeneous Computing
C++ class for signal processing, async network programming, concurrency, parallel computing and multithreading
C++ light-weight Thread Pool library
C++ class for signal processing, async network programming, concurrency, parallel computing and multithreading
This C++20 solution enables lazy initialization for multithreaded tasks. It efficiently initializes an expensive object only when needed, ensuring thread safety. It utilizes std::once_flag and std::atomic<bool> for synchronization, optimizing resource utilization and scalability.
A Python platform to perform parallel computations of optimisation tasks (global and local) via the asynchronous generalized island model.
A C++ platform to perform parallel computations of optimisation tasks (global and local) via the asynchronous generalized island model.
Academic Lab Course of the 27th batch of Computer Science & Engineering | University of Rajshahi - 🇧🇩
This repository features MPI and CUDA parallel computing programs exploring concepts such as matrix multiplication, word counting, synchronous communication, array addition, and CUDA-based algorithms.
Application for simulation of solid state sensor response
Final for CPS 376 - Parallel Computing.
C++ class for signal processing, async network programming, concurrency, parallel computing and multithreading
Code for Distributed Systems course assignments
FFRend (Freeframe Renderer) is a renderer for Freeframe plugins.
A parallel pipeline for stream processing
Add a description, image, and links to the parallel-processing topic page so that developers can more easily learn about it.
To associate your repository with the parallel-processing topic, visit your repo's landing page and select "manage topics."